The Manager, Channel Sales West at Cox Business is responsible for leading an outside sales team to achieve sales goals in the assigned region. This role involves hiring, training, and coaching sales representatives while ensuring adherence to corporate sales strategies. The position is crucial for customer acquisition, growth, and retention, and requires a strong focus on building a successful sales culture and territory strategy.

  • Lead and manage an outside sales team to achieve Cox Business sales goals.
  • Hire, train, and coach outside sales and retention representatives in the assigned region.
  • Develop and implement regional sales plans that drive business through indirect selling.
  • Split time 50/50 between leading the sales team and meeting with customers and partners.
  • Collaborate with extended sales resources to plan and execute cohesive sales campaigns.
  • Work closely with Channel Partners to drive transactional growth.
  • Develop a professional sales culture and serve as a role model for the sales team.
  • Coach and manage the performance of Agent Channel Managers to meet revenue growth targets.
  • Ensure consistent sales approaches are used by Sales Representatives to uncover customer needs.
  • Facilitate strategic planning to maximize market share and revenue.
  • Assign accounts to appropriate sales channels and set sales goals for outside sales representatives.
  • Develop account forecasts and manage the sales team to achieve maximum revenue while maintaining profitability.
